Discovered that the oil filters on the petrol empty over night, like most of us only change a filter after getting the oil hot, but as the oil pressure switch had failed on the off roader, it is easier to remove the filter to get at it, and was waiting for the normal oil spill, but nothing, not one drop, the filter was dry, now I had assumed that the rubber membrane that can be seen through the small holes should have stopped that, (this was a coopers/fiamm filter) so having a firstline filter on the skip cut it up and the rubber fits and looks good to do the job, so watch this space , I will cut up a coopers very soon and see the difference, together with pics, Rick
 
OK well got a new Coopers filter and half filled it with oil, (needs time to settle) then put it on its side oil up to the threads, and oil started leaking immediately, five mins and it was all gone, did the same with two others that my factors got special for me and on both it took probably ten mins for them to start to leak, but leak they did so a bit disappointed, if I cannot find a filter that will hold its oil at least over night, then I will be modding the filter housings so the filter stays full, the reason behind all this is to stop cold start rattle with dry big ends till the oil gets through, all this metal to metal contact is bad news, with a coopers filter I can start up to around 5-6 hours later with no noise at all, hopefully with one of the others (forgot the names) it will last till the morning or more, Rick
